If your 3G iPhone is not jailbroken yet, when you do jailbreak, insert your T-Mobile simcard so that when you connect to iTunes, it won't tell you that you have invalid simcard.
If you don't want your phone jailbroken, you can slightly pop up the simcard tray (not all the way out but just enough for your phone to tell you that you do not have a simcard inserted). Then, connect your phone to iTunes, it will still recognize your phone and you can sync whatever you want and then just close the simcard tray when you're done.
